Marc quit his job and started Marathon Camp for young adults. Marc asks you to help him prepare financial statements at the end of his first year of operations. He relates the following facts about his business activities.

  • In order to get the business off the ground, he decided to start a private company. He issues shares in Marc Mara Pty Ltd to a few close friends, as well as buying some of the shares himself. He initially raised $75,000 through these shares. In addition, he took a bank loan for $100,000 from Unity Bank.
  • He purchased a bus for transporting his clients for $40,000 cash.
  • He purchased equipment for $3,000 cash.
  • He earned fees from his clients during the year $200,000, but had collected only $140,000 of this amount. His clients still owed him $60,000.
  • He rents a local school playground for $150 per day. Total rental expenses for the playground were $8,000, insurance was $20,000, salary expenses were $45,000, and administrative expenses were $15,700, all of which were paid in cash.
  • The company incurred $2,000 in interest expense on the bank loan which was not paid at the end of the year.
  • The company paid dividends during the year $16,000 cash.
  • The balance in the companys bank account at the end of the year, 30 June 2020, was $ 167,300.

For the year ended 30 June 2020, prepare a (a) Statement of Financial Performance (Profit and Loss) (b) Statement of Changes in Equity (Retained Earnings) (c) Statement of Financial Position (Balance Sheet) (d) Statement of Cash Flows
